Rumours were circulating at Shrewsbury last night that City are ready to snap up striker Grant Holt.
Holt has been linked with the Canaries this summer and was made unavailable to play for the Shrews in their friendly with West Brom last night.
When asked about the Norwich link, Shrews manager Paul Simpson simply replied that Holt was unavailable to play.
The Canaries' protracted chase for Simon Whaley is also ongoing, as City's new “robust” procedure for medicals continues to delay the player's unveiling.
Winger Whaley's move from Preston, believed to be for around �150,000, could well be rubber stamped at a press conference tomorrow.
